Colony Ford Lincoln is currently looking for a Licensed Automotive Service Technician to join their team in Brampton. The Licensed Technician is responsible for skilled tasks in the mechanical repair and maintenance of vehicles. The candidate must be able to analyze, troubleshoot, dismantle, align, assemble and adjust mechanical equipment and machinery to maintain it in efficient operating condition.

Job Duties:
- Perform vehicle maintenance and repairs as assigned.
- Diagnose the source of any malfunctions and perform repair.
- Qualify all vehicles for warranty coverage prior to performing warranty repairs.
- Examine vehicles to determine if additional safety or service work is required.
- Perform road tests using safe driving standards.
What We Look For:
- Valid Automotive Service Technician Certification of Qualification (Class A).
- Minimum 2 years+ experience working in a technician position.
- Valid Driver’s License (Class G) with a clean driving record.
- Experience with domestic brands would be considered an asset.
- Strong aptitude of technical/mechanical repairs.
- Good time management skills.
-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
- Able to work well with a team.
- A desire to achieve the very best in customer service and teamwork.
